在X Yosomite上,
运行ng new my-app
新应用创建没有问题。运行ng serve --open
会在Safari浏览器中打开一个标签,但只显示默认的src/index.html
文件。
此外,还会对index.html进行实时更新并在浏览器中显示。
但是,当我在Firefox中打开网址http://localhost:4200
时,我可以看到正确的结果(App component
和Module
的结果)。
我的问题是:
ng serve --open
无法与Safari配合使用吗?
这有点烦人,因为我无法将Firefox设置为Angular CLI的默认浏览器。
答案 0 :(得分:0)
它可能不是浏览器问题。
您是否尝试过使用ng serve --live-reload --open
我在使用ng serve --open
https://github.com/angular/angular-cli/wiki/serve处的文档声称默认情况下会进行实时重新加载,但对我来说这不是真的。我现在不能说为什么。